Yes, I have tons of photos and videos to post, but not for awhile yet. we havepower to the airport and hospital now, and our frame relay circuits came up with the power, so the 4 computers in the IT dept were quickly re-routed to get on the internet over that connection and here I am. That Inmarsat antenna with it's base station cost about $10,000 and costs $2.00 per minute to $7.00 per minute depending on which channel/sats/provider you happen to get. it has a wireless base station (and 2 handsets) as well as ISDN(rj45) USB, 9 pin serial connections for data.
